Outing Riley
"One of these brothers is not like the others..."
Originally released in 2004. Outing Riley is a comedy film. directed by Pete Jones. At just 86 minutes, it's a tight, focused story.
Starring Pete Jones, Nathan Fillion, and Stoney Westmoreland
Synopsis
Bobby Riley is an affable Irish-American guy-next-door, gay and still in the closet. Bobby's discomfort with being openly gay is a source of friction in his relationship with his partner, Andy. His sister, straight-talking lawyer Maggie, knows Bobby's secret, and when their father dies, she persuades him to come out to his three brothers. The revelation doesn't just surprise his brothers, it forces some other family secrets to be revealed.
